Abstract :
Continuous change is not a new phenomenon for supply chain management (SCM). However the rate, scale and unpredictability of change in today´s business environment are seriously challenging supply chains. This paper proposes the need for a greater understanding of relationship between supply chain integration (SCI) and supply chain collaboration (SCC) and the importance to study SCI models with collaboration theory. Thus the paper is organized as follows: First, we make a presentation of the necessity to research on supply chains by combining the integration with collaboration, and propose that SCC is the development trend of SCM; then a model for dynamic supply chain integration network based on collaboration theory is developed and will be discussed in different hierarchies; and the end, the model will be analyzed with non-linear Polya processes. The result will be used in the next stage of research.
